It may sound odd, but a frozen salad will keep you chilled through

Ingredients

  • 1 cos lettuce – shredded
  • 1 sliced red onion
  • 3 sticks celery – chopped
  • 1 tin water chestnuts – chopped
  • 1 small packet frozen peas
  • half a jar of light mayonnaise
  • a packet of cooked, smoked, chopped turkey rashers (available from Matheson)
  • 2 eggs

Method: How to make frozen salad

1. Arrange the lettuce, onion, celery, water chestnuts and peas on a flat bottomed dish in layers.

2. Pour over half a jar of light mayonnaise.

3. Cover with clingfilm and leave overnight in fridge.

4. The next day, cover with 1 packet of cooked, chopped smoked turkey rashers, and 2 thinly sliced hard boiled eggs.

5. For an alternative, try prawns and sliced tomatoes, or peppers and olives for vegetarians.
